BackupChain Backup Software With Granular Backup and Restore for Hyper-V, Version 2.4 Released
BALTIMORE, MD--(Marketwire - Jul 16, 2012) - FastNeuron Inc., a leading U.S. provider of disaster recovery and data protection solutions for physical, virtual, and cloud environments, announced today its new release of BackupChain® Backup Software.
Initially launched in 2009, BackupChain Backup Software rapidly expanded internationally as the product of choice for IT administrators and professionals.
The new version and edition of the product has been released today -- Server Enterprise Edition -- includes an innovative twist to virtualization backup: Granular Backup and Granular Restore. The two main new features work in Hyper-V, VMware, and VirtualBox. For most users these features result in significant backup and recovery time reductions.
Using Granular Backup, BackupChain users may now run a host-based backup of objects residing inside virtual machines without installing additional software or virtual machine agents. Granular Backup cuts processing time because users may choose to back up only certain files, rather than the entire virtual machine.
Granular Restore, on the other hand, allows users to selectively restore individual objects from virtual machine backups, without the need to restore entire virtual disks, which may take hours for very large machines.
In addition to the new Server Enterprise Edition, all other editions were also updated and include new features, such as configurable file retention, delayed deletion periods, and various performance-related options.
